Story #11857

[CWL] arvados-cwl-runner defaults to crunch2 if available

Added by Peter Amstutz 3 months ago. Updated 2 months ago.

Status:RejectedStart date:07/10/2017
Priority:NormalDue date:
Assignee:Radhika Chippada% Done:

100%

Category:-
Target version:2017-07-19 sprint
Story points0.5Remaining (hours)0.00 hour
Velocity based estimate-

Description

Upgrading to master should advise using the configuration option disable_api_methods to disable the container APIs if you're not ready for this default to change on your site.


Subtasks

Task #11955: Review 11857-acr-default-crunch2ResolvedLucas Di Pentima


Related issues

Related to Arvados - Bug #11965: arvados-cwl-runner --help --api default needs to be changed Closed 07/12/2017

Associated revisions

Revision edf37e92
Added by Radhika Chippada 3 months ago

refs #11857

Merge branch '11857-acr-default-crunch2'

Arvados-DCO-1.1-Signed-off-by: Radhika Chippada <>

Revision 281cf578
Added by Tom Clegg 2 months ago

Revert "Merge branch '11857-acr-default-crunch2'" (edf37e92f885ed4d5bcf587317cc9c6d90d8ece1)

refs #11857

Arvados-DCO-1.1-Signed-off-by: Tom Clegg <>

History

#1 Updated by Peter Amstutz 3 months ago

  • Description updated (diff)

#2 Updated by Tom Morris 3 months ago

  • Target version changed from Arvados Future Sprints to 2017-07-05 sprint

#3 Updated by Tom Clegg 3 months ago

  • Subject changed from [Docs] Document use of disable_api_methods in install guide to [CWL] arvados-cwl-runner defaults to crunch2 if available
  • Description updated (diff)

#4 Updated by Tom Morris 3 months ago

  • Target version changed from 2017-07-05 sprint to 2017-07-19 sprint

#5 Updated by Tom Morris 3 months ago

  • Assignee set to Peter Amstutz
  • Story points set to 0.5

#6 Updated by Tom Morris 3 months ago

  • Assignee changed from Peter Amstutz to Radhika Chippada

#7 Updated by Radhika Chippada 3 months ago

Added the following to Upgrading to master:

2017-07-10: #11857 edf37e9 defaults to containers api if available.

  • If you are not ready to use containers api as the default for your site, you can disable the containers api using the API server configuration option disable_api_methods
     disable_api_methods:  ["containers.create"] 
  • Alternatively, pass --api=jobs to the arvados-cwl-runner command to bypass the default and use jobs api

#8 Updated by Lucas Di Pentima 3 months ago

This LGTM, thanks.

#9 Updated by Tom Clegg 2 months ago

  • Status changed from New to In Progress

#10 Updated by Tom Clegg 2 months ago

Reverted merge. Turns out we weren't really ready for this.

#11 Updated by Radhika Chippada 2 months ago

  • Status changed from In Progress to Rejected

Also available in: Atom PDF